The place was easy to find, presentable and clean inside. As a first time customer my first impressions were mainly positive. Staff was friendly and prompt, and prices were ok for the portions. On the not so positive side you pay an extra fee or percentage increase if using your credit/debit card to pay as this is mainly a 'cash preferred' type of place. The menu prices are cash only, the card transaction pays more, but nobody said anything I just happened to read it. The menu choices I found online were very different from the actual location, and such main ordering menu is away from where you order (maybe to prevent new comers from blocking the checkout area?) For me, in this day and age, it's not the way to keep my business. The food was ok, left me expecting a little more moist, fluff, and seasoning out of my scrambled eggs, rye (over) toast and home fries.

What a great find!! Coming home from the casino and craving some good breakfast sandwich, we found this spot by both google and Yelp reviews. Adorable inside, the friendliest staff and the bacon, sausage, egg and cheese on a hard roll was AWESOME. The iced coffee was delicious, and came with coffee ice cubes!! We will definitely be back and I highly recomend! Check out the last picture of my iced coffee with coffee ice, two hours after I bought it. Not watered down at all, due to the “coffee ice”. Love this idea!!

Almond crusted paleo chicken, and buffalo chicken chili were delicious. Paleo choc chip banana bread was moist and really well balanced. Normally when I have an end piece, it's dry enough to be a fire hazard, but somehow this wasn't the case here. Not the quickest service in the world as they only have 2 people working the grill, near as I could tell, but definitely worth the wait. Coconut almond truffle was great, too. Picked up a veggie quiche with sweet potato crust (frozen) to take home, too.
